At Vestas, we're committed to transforming the global energy landscape through sustainable solutions. As the world's largest wind turbine manufacturer, we've installed over 177 GW …
Posting Detail Information Working Title Internal: Geographic Information Systems (GIS) Coordinator Position Location Fort Collins, CO Work Location Position qualifies for hybr…
Posting Detail Information Working Title Natural/Cultural Resources Specialist-Pentagon Position Location Washington, VA Work Location Position qualifies for hybrid/in-office w…